이미지 다운로드란?
Docker에서 컨테이너를 실행하려면 먼저 이미지(Image) 가 필요합니다.
이미지는 컨테이너를 만들기 위한 설정된 환경(운영체제 + 애플리케이션 + 설정값) 을 담고 있습니다.
이 이미지는 보통 Dockerhub라는 중앙 저장소에서 다운로드받게 됩니다.
GitHub이 코드를 저장하고 공유하는 공간이라면,
Dockerhub은 이미지 파일을 저장하고 공유하는 공간이라고 생각하면 됩니다.
최신 버전 이미지 다운로드
아래 명령으로 최신 버전(latest) 이미지를 받을 수 있습니다.
docker pull 이미지명
예시 👇
docker pull nginx
이 명령은 docker pull nginx:latest 와 동일하게 작동하며,
nginx의 최신 버전 이미지를 Dockerhub에서 자동으로 내려받습니다.
Pull complete 메시지가 뜨면 다운로드가 완료된 것입니다.
특정 버전 이미지 다운로드
특정 버전의 이미지를 받고 싶다면 태그(tag) 를 함께 지정하면 됩니다.
docker pull 이미지명:태그명
예시 👇
docker pull nginx:stable-perl
- 콜론(:) 뒤의 태그명은 버전이나 변형된 환경을 구분하는 역할을 합니다.
- 사용할 수 있는 태그 목록은 Dockerhub에서 이미지 페이지를 열어 확인할 수 있습니다.
정리하면
Dockerhub는 이미지 저장소이고,
🔹 docker pull 명령을 통해 원하는 이미지를 다운로드받을 수 있다.
🔹 태그(:latest, :stable, :1.25)를 이용해 버전을 명확히 지정할 수 있다.
'컨테이너·워크플로우 자동화 > DocKer 기본 및 활용' 카테고리의 다른 글
| Docker 컨테이너(Container) 생성과 실행 (0) | 2025.10.11 |
|---|---|
| Docker 이미지(Image) 조회 및 삭제 정리 (0) | 2025.10.11 |
| Docker란? 컨테이너(Container)란? 이미지(Image)란? (0) | 2025.10.11 |
| 협업에서는 왜 Docker를 이렇게 많이 쓸까? (0) | 2025.10.11 |
| GitLab Docker 설정에서 $GITLAB_HOME은 호스트일까? 컨테이너일까? (0) | 2025.04.22 |